A week or so ago, a list member asked about who was going to Dayton and if there would be a get-together of Greenkeyers.
The telegraph group that I belong to started doing that a few years ago and we have had a booth at the Dayton Hamvention the last 2 years. This will be our 3rd year.
We demonstrate the instruments, try to teach the visitors a little bit about what we do and then encourage them to participate either by joining our club or using our online virtual telegraph wire. It has been very successful the past few years and I often wondered if a teletype group could do the same thing.
We *plan* to have 3 morse "offices" at the Hamvention this year:
1) The Morse Telegraph Club booth (Booth No. SA-0305 )
2) The Vibroplex booth (right next to the Morse Telegraph Club booth)
3) The Begali key booth
We may not have operators at all booths at all times but we should have a "presence" at all three booths and an operator at the main Morse Telegraph Club booth.
Here is a video of our booth last year....it gets boring after a few moments but it at least shows you what is possible if the greenkeyers wanted to do something. Look how many people are interested in the old gear....
http://www.youtube.com/user/cruisevideo1#p/a/u/0/N6G4tevQqyA
Having a greenkeys booth might be a great way to promote the salvage and use of these wonderful machines. For a fee, you can get an internet connection in Hara Arena (we will have one) and could run ITTY until you were ankle deep in yellow paper.
